Marketing · Toronto, Canada · Founded 2006 · IPO 2021

Q4 Inc. is a leading provider of investor relations solutions, serving public companies, investors, and banks within the capital markets ecosystem. The company operates a comprehensive platform that aggregates a vast amount of proprietary and public data, including regulatory filings and historical trading data, to deliver actionable insights and recommendations in real time. This data-driven approach helps clients make informed decisions about investor behavior and trading activities. Q4's business model is highly resilient and predictable, characterized by strong unit economics, high customer satisfaction, low churn rates, and low customer acquisition costs. The company generates revenue through subscription-based services and aims for continued organic growth. Additionally, Q4 is exploring transformative mergers and acquisitions to integrate point solutions into its platform, further enhancing its value proposition. The company serves a diverse range of clients, including public companies, investors, and banks, representing a total addressable market (TAM) of $20 billion. Q4's platform is designed to centralize data and streamline meeting workflows, making it easier for clients to identify and engage with the best-fit investors.
